摘要
The electrotopological state (E-state) is presented as a representation of molecular structure useful for definition of a space for chemical structures. This E-state representation provides the basis for chemical database management. The E-state formalism is presented along with its extension to the atom-type E-state. An approach to database organization, using polychlorobiphenyls (PCBs) as examples, reveals the descriptive power of the E-state paradigm. A well-organized chemical database, as described here, may be searched to find structures similar to a target structure with the expectation that such structures may exhibit properties similar to the target. Searches using the atom-type E-state indices are demonstrated with two example drug molecules.
